A common misconception is that the "assessment fee" covers the whole procedure. In truth, the course to handling ADHD independently is divided into a number of monetary stages.
1. The Initial Assessment Fee
The assessment itself is the most substantial in advance expense. This includes a thorough review of the patient's history, making use of standardized diagnostic tools (such as the DIVA-5 for grownups), and interviews with "informants" (parents or partners who can speak to the client's behavior).
2. Post-Diagnostic Follow-ups and Titration
If a medical diagnosis is verified and the client selects pharmacological treatment, they get in the "titration" stage. This is the duration where a psychiatrist keeps an eye on the patient as they trial various medications and dosages to find the most effective and safest balance. Each titration appointment typically sustains a separate [Cost Of ADHD Assessment](https://la.biznet-us.com/out.php).
3. Medication Costs
Private prescriptions are not subsidized. While a patient is under the care of a private center, they need to pay the complete market cost for their medication at the drug store, in addition to a charge for the clinician to compose and issue the prescription.

Not all private assessments are priced equally. Numerous variables can drive the price towards the greater or lower end sought by suppliers.
The Qualifications of the Clinician
Assessments are normally performed by either a Consultant Psychiatrist or a Specialist Psychologist.
Psychiatrists are medical doctors who can recommend medication. Their assessments are frequently more costly however provide a "one-stop shop" for medical diagnosis and treatment.Psychologists can identify ADHD and deal behavior modifications, but they can not prescribe medication. If a patient is identified by a psychologist and desires medication, they might need to spend for a 2nd assessment with a psychiatrist.Geographic Location
Clinics situated in major metropolitan centers like London, New York, or Sydney naturally command higher fees due to increased overhead costs. Remote or "Telehealth" assessments have ended up being a popular method to decrease expenses, as these service providers typically have lower overheads and can pass those cost savings to the patient.
Adult vs. Child Assessments
Pediatric assessments typically require more intensive cooperation with schools and several member of the family. Due to the fact that of the additional documentation and coordination with instructional psychologists, child ADHD assessments can in some cases be 20% to 30% more costly than [Adult ADHD Assessments](http://www.google.com/url?q=https://reimer-alvarado.blogbright.net/15-interesting-facts-about-adhd-consultation-youve-never-known) assessments.

Among the most crucial financial aspects of a private ADHD medical diagnosis is the Shared Care Agreement (SCA). Once a client is stabilized on medication through a private center, the private psychiatrist may ask for that the patient's primary care physician (GP) take control of the prescribing duties.

If the GP accepts:
The client pays the standard public/subsidized rate for prescriptions (e.g., the flat NHS prescription charge).The patient just needs to go back to the private expert once a year for an evaluation.
Care: Not all GPs are needed to accept Shared Care Agreements. If a GP declines-- which is ending up being more common due to different regulatory issues-- the patient must continue to pay private prices for both the appointments and the medication indefinitely. This can cause a long-lasting monetary commitment of countless pounds annually.

Will my medical insurance cover a private ADHD assessment?
Many private medical insurance suppliers consider ADHD a "chronic condition" or a "neurodevelopmental condition," which are typically excluded from basic policies. Nevertheless, some premium policies or business plans might cover the initial diagnostic assessment, though they hardly ever cover the continuous expense of medication.
2. Why is the cost of medication so high?
Without government aids, patients are paying the producer's rate plus the pharmacy's mark-up. Brand-name stimulants (like Vyvanse or Concerta) are substantially more pricey than generic equivalents.
3. Can I take my private diagnosis back to the public health system?
In theory, yes. However, public health suppliers are not strictly obligated to accept a private medical diagnosis. They might insist on a "medical validation" or put the patient back by themselves waiting list for a secondary assessment before taking control of treatment.
4. Is a private assessment "better" than a public one?
Not necessarily. The diagnostic requirements utilized (ICD-11 or DSM-5) are the exact same. The "quality" of the assessment depends on the proficiency of the private clinician, not the price paid. The primary benefit of private care is speed and convenience.
5. What if I can not pay for the titration fees?
Some clinics use a "medical diagnosis only" service. While this doesn't assist with medication, it provides an official report that can be utilized to gain access to work environment support or therapy, which might be more cost effective than a medical path.
